Salvia dorrii
Desert Sage
Salvia dorrii produces whorls of violet-blue flowers surrounded by mauve-pink bracts in late spring to early summer, attracting bees, butterflies, and other pollinators. Narrow, aromatic leaves are silvery gray and softly textured, forming a dense mound. The foliage releases a distinctive herbal fragrance when brushed, while the flowers are carried on upright stems above the leaves, adding color and structure during bloom.
Native to the arid regions of the western United States, this species is adapted to open landscapes and rocky terrain.
